Get in Touch** The Audi repair market in the Wichita area (the logical service hub for a location like Stark, KS) is robust and competitive, characterized by a handful of high-quality independent specialists. These shops successfully compete with the local Audi dealership by offering comparable or superior technical expertise, often at a lower labor rate. The average quality is high, as these businesses survive by mastering the complexities of German engineering. Customers typically have a choice between a dealership experience and several well-regarded independents that focus on personalized service and performance. Pricing is premium compared to general repair shops, reflecting the specialized tools, training, and OEM/OES parts required. A typical diagnostic fee ranges from $150-$200, with major services like a DSG service costing $400-$600 and turbo replacement jobs running several thousand dollars.

Common questions about audi repair services in Stark, KS
Stark is a small community, so there are no dedicated Audi dealerships or specialists within the town itself. For specialized Audi repair, owners typically travel to authorized dealerships or independent German auto specialists in larger regional hubs like Wichita or Dodge City, which are equipped with the necessary diagnostic tools and certified technicians.
The gravel and rough rural roads around Stark can be tough on suspension components and wheel alignment. Additionally, Kansas temperature extremes and road salt in winter can accelerate corrosion and strain the cooling and electrical systems, making these areas frequent repair points for local Audi drivers.
Due to the need for specialized parts and expertise, Audi repairs generally cost more than standard domestic vehicles. For basic services, expect premium pricing, but costs can vary significantly between shops in nearby larger towns. Always request a detailed estimate upfront, as labor rates and parts sourcing can differ.
Look for a shop that explicitly lists European or German automotive service and has technicians with Audi-specific training (ASE certifications are a plus). They should use proper diagnostic software (like VAG-COM/VCDS) and quality OEM or equivalent parts. Checking online reviews for shops in neighboring cities is highly recommended.
For critical warnings like engine overheating, oil pressure, or serious brake system alerts, seek immediate local mechanical assistance in Stark to prevent further damage, even if it's not Audi-specific. For less urgent check engine lights or scheduled maintenance, it's best to plan a trip to a specialized shop for an accurate diagnosis.
